I cannot sync the droid eris with my mac via bluetooth, nor usb.

In attempts to sync it via bluetooth, it says paired, but not connected.

Via USB, no drive shows up in my finder while the eris is connected.

Can anyone help me with this? My macbook is a year old and running snow leopord.

What are you trying to sync?

To mount your Eris as a drive, plug it in via USB and go to your notifications pane. Then select "USB Connected" and then "Mount."

With trial and error and my wife's USB cord I figured out the issue was a bad USB cord. Make sure you check to make sure the connection is not loose or wobbly coming out of the phone's CORD connection.

TEST YOUR USB CORD!
